Levodopa Does Speed Progression – Part 7- Gastrointestinal & Metabolic Instability:
Levodopa doesn’t always get absorbed the same way. Parkinson’s slows the gut, protein competes with the drug, and the result is unpredictable ON-OFF swings. These sudden OFFs increase falls, fear, and frailty.
On top of that, levodopa metabolism raises homocysteine a toxic by-product linked to dementia, strokes, heart disease, and bone fractures. Patients on levodopa often have 20-40% higher levels, meaning 2-3x higher dementia risk and~2x fracture risk.
Solutions exist: B vitamins, protein timing, and gut-focused treatments can reduce the burden.
